Pasta is one of the components of the Mediterranean Diet, despite considerable attention given, its use is still debated. Several studies encouraged the consumption of whole grain because of its many properties and the positive association between refined carbohydrates and insulin resistance, by measuring the Glycaemic Index (GI), an indicator of the physiological effects of a carbohydrate meal. In this study, the GI and polyphenol content of Senatore Cappelli (Triticum turgidum ssp. durum) pasta were evaluated. Using spectrophotometric methods, total polyphenols and flavonoids were found to be 113.5 mg/100 g and 52.96 mg/100 g, respectively. To measure the GI, a standard assay was performed, and values of 47.9 ± 5.2 for long format pasta and 68.5 ± 4.6 for short format pasta were obtained. The present study confirms the presence of polyphenols and flavonoids in pasta Senatore Cappelli. The value of GI is influenced by the pasta shape. These informations could provide valuable data for practitioners preparing personalised diets.

PURPOSE: The aim of our study is to evaluate taste changes in patients affected by solid tumors not involving oral cavity within the first month of standard chemotherapy. METHODS: In this monocentric, prospective, cohort study, we enrolled patients treated at our institution for different types of solid tumors between February and July 2019. Taste cotton swabs assay was used to assess taste changes. RESULTS: Thirty-one patients were enrolled and most of them had at least one change in taste. The taste that changed less was acid (42% of the population) whereas the one that changed the most was the perception of sweet (reduced in 35% of the population and increased in 45% of the population) and sour (reduced in 35% of the population). We did not find any statistical significant difference in terms of changes of taste and type of chemotherapy (emetogenic vs not, p > 0.05 for salty, sweet, bitter, and acid tastes). The type of primary tumor (breast vs GI-related) had a significant impact on perception of both salty (p = 0.0163) and acid (p = 0.0312) flavor. Furthermore, body mass composition assessed by BIA showed that obese patients had different changes in acid flavor vs non-obese patients (p = 0.04). This could not be proven when the assessment was made using BMI calculation. CONCLUSIONS: Our study suggests that type of primary tumor (GI vs breast) more than type of chemotherapy used could be relevant in determining changes in taste during chemotherapy. Individualized dietary strategies based on these reported data are suggested, as to optimize patients' management.

PURPOSE: Taste changes due to chemotherapy may contribute to the high prevalence of malnutrition in cancer patients. It is believed that 50-70% of patients with cancer suffer from taste disorders. The aim of the present study was to analyze the taste alterations in patient population compared with that in controls, also in relation to gender. In this way, it could open to a new approach for a personalized diet to prevent and/or reduce taste alterations and malnutrition in cancer patients. METHODS: Forty-five cancer patients undergoing chemotherapy were compared with healthy controls (n = 32). Taste function test was used to determine taste sensitivity. Different concentrations for each of the four basic tastes (salty, sweet, sour, bitter) and also fat and water tastes were evaluated. RESULTS: A significant difference in taste sensitivity between patients and control group was found, in line with previous similar studies. As in the control group, taste perception in patients was better in females than in males, suggesting interaction effect between group and gender. CONCLUSIONS: Coping strategies regarding subjective taste impairment should be provided since alterations in taste sensitivity influence food preferences and appetite. Clinicians could thus have the potential to underpin changes in dietary intake and consequently in nutritional status; understanding the extent of the contribution of each taste would help in the development of effective interventions in future. Consequently, patients can adopt appropriate appetizing strategies and, based on that, change their feeding habits.

Background and Objectives: Masticatory limitations on the dietary habits of edentulous subjects restrict their access to adequate nutrition, exposing them to a greater risk of protein energy malnutrition. The aim of this study is to verify the existence of an association between Masticatory Performance (MP) and nutritional changes in the elderly. Materials and Methods: 76 participants were enrolled. MP testing was performed using the two-color chewing gum mixing test. The system used reveals the extent to which the two differently colored chewing gums mix, and allows discrimination between different MPs. The assessment of the participants' nutritional statuses was carried out through a food interview. Anthropometric parameters were collected, and bioimpedance analysis was performed. Results: Mean MP was 0.448 ± 0.188. No statistically significant differences were detected between male and female subjects (p > 0.05). According to the Body Mass Index (BMI), obese patients had a lower MP than overweight and normal weight subjects (0.408 ± 0.225, 0.453 ± 0.169 and 0.486 ± 0.181, respectively). MP values were lower both in male and female subjects with a waist circumference above the threshold than those below it (0.455 ± 0.205 vs. 0.476 ± 0.110, respectively, in males and 0.447 ± 0.171 vs. 0.501 ± 0.138, respectively, in females). No relationship was noticed between MP and bioimpedance parameters (p > 0.05). Conclusions: A statistically significant relation was observed between MP and the number of missing teeth. A reduced MP could worsen nutritional parameters. A reduced MP did not seem to negatively affect bioimpedance parameters.

Background: The inter-individual differences in taste perception find a possible rationale in genetic variations. We verified whether the presence of four different single nucleotide polymorphisms (SNPs) in genes encoding for bitter (TAS2R38; 145G > C; 785T > C) and sweet (TAS1R3; −1572C > T; −1266C > T) taste receptors influenced the recognition of the basic tastes. Furthermore, we tested if the allelic distribution of such SNPs varied according to BMI and whether the associations between SNPs and taste recognition were influenced by the presence of overweight/obesity. Methods: DNA of 85 overweight/obese patients and 57 normal weight volunteers was used to investigate the SNPs. For the taste test, filter paper strips were applied. Each of the basic tastes (sweet, sour, salty, bitter) plus pure rapeseed oil, and water were tested. Results: Individuals carrying the AV/AV diplotype of the TAS2R38 gene (A49P G/G and V262 T/T) were less sensitive to sweet taste recognition. These alterations remained significant after adjustment for gender and BMI. Moreover, a significant decrease in overall taste recognition associated with BMI and age was found. There was no significant difference in allelic distribution for the investigated polymorphisms between normal and overweight/obese patients. Conclusions: Our findings suggest that overall taste recognition depends on age and BMI. In the total population, the inter-individual ability to identify the sweet taste at different concentrations was related to the presence of at least one genetic variant for the bitter receptor gene but not to the BMI.

Declining gustatory function, nutrition, and oral health are important elements of health in older adults that can affect the aging process. The aim of the present work was to investigate the effect of age and oral status on taste discrimination in two different groups of elderly subjects living either in an Italian residential institution (TG) or in the community (CG). A total of 90 subjects were enrolled in the study (58 CG vs. 32 TG). Masticatory performance (MP) was assessed using the two-color mixing ability test. Taste function was evaluated using cotton pads soaked with six taste stimuli (salty, acid, sweet, bitter, fat and water). A positive correlation between age and missing teeth (r = 0.51, C.I. [0.33; 0.65], p < 0.0001), and a negative correlation between age and MP (r = -0.39, C.I. [-0.56; -0.20], p < 0.001) were found. Moreover, significant differences for salty taste, between TG and CG were detected (p < 0.05). Significant differences in bitter taste sensitivity between subjects wearing removable and non-removable prosthesis were also determined (p < 0.05). In addition, significant gender differences and between males in TG and CG were identified (p < 0.05). The best understanding of the relationship between MP, taste sensitivity, and nutritional factors is a necessary criterion for the development of new therapeutic strategies to address more effectively the problems associated with malnutrition in elderly subjects.

The global population aged over 60 will double by 2050. This pilot cross-sectional study aims at evaluating nutritional and oral health status and the prevalence of sarcopenia in older adults living in an Italian residential aged care facility. Thirty-two adults aged ≥65 years were included. Individual sociodemographic data and nutritional and oral health data were collected. For sarcopenia diagnosis, muscle mass, physical performance, muscle strength and anthropometric parameters were recorded. Participants underwent a nutritional screening and a dental examination. Mini Nutritional Assessment and masticatory mixing ability test were performed. The results showed that men recorded a hand strength significantly higher than that of women, 25.5 ± 7.2 Kg vs. 12.8 ± 5.9 Kg (p < 0.01), respectively. Gait speed test showed that only 20.8% of the participants had a speed of more than 0.8 m/s. A strong negative correlation between masticatory performance and the number of missing teeth was detected (r = -0.84, 95% C.I. [-0.92; -0.69], p < 0.01). Overall, a high percentage of institutionalized older adults were diagnosed as being sarcopenic. Poor oral health in older adults is a major general health problem as it may restrict both food selection and nutrient intake, representing a risk factor for sarcopenia, although longitudinal studies are needed to confirm this relationship.

Type 2 diabetes mellitus (T2DM) has a very high impact on quality of life as it is characterized by disabling complications. There is little evidence about taste alterations in diabetes. Since many individual factors are involved in the onset of diabetes, the purpose of our study is to search a possible link between diabetes and individual taste function. Thirty-two participants with T2DM and 32 volunteers without T2DM (healthy controls) were recruited. Four concentrations of each of the four basic tastes (sweet, sour, salty, bitter), and pure rapeseed oil and water, were applied with cotton pads to the protruded tongue, immediately posterior to its first third, either to the left or right side. The results showed significant differences between groups in the ability to recognize sour, bitter, sweet, and water. Taste scores were lower in subjects with T2DM than in healthy controls, and an age-related decline in taste function was found. The taste function reduction associated with T2DM was not related to gender, disease duration, and glycemic control. In conclusion, it can be hypothesized that a general alteration of taste function can lead patients with type 2 diabetes to search for foods richer in sugars, as in a vicious circle, thus decreasing the likelihood of remission of diabetes mellitus.

Alzheimer's disease (AD) is the most common cause of dementia accounting for 60-70% of all demented cases and one of the leading sources of morbidity and mortality in the aging population. Most of the recent literature regards the relationship between plasma oxidative stress and AD, showing that markers of lipid peroxidation are significantly higher in AD and Mild Cognitive Impairment (MCI) patients with respect to control subjects. The increased generation of reactive oxygen species that occurs in AD may be also responsible for oxidative injury to erythrocyte membranes. Since erythrocyte membrane serves as a variable barrier to oxygen transport, changes in its stability can induce cellular hypoxia and the consequence brain tissue oxygenation. In this study, plasma oxygen radical absorbance capacity (ORAC) and erythrocyte membrane fluidity have been evaluated in control, MCI and AD patients. Moreover erythrocyte membrane acetylcholinesterase (AchE) activity has been measured in control and AD patients. Plasma ORAC significantly decreased in MCI and AD subjects with respect to the controls, while a decrease in erythrocyte membrane fluidity has been observed only in MCI patients. No significant differences were detected in erythrocyte AchE activity between control subjects and AD patients.

BACKGROUND AND OBJECTIVES: The present study was conducted to evaluate the relationship between taste identification ability and body mass index (BMI) by studying the response to the administration of different taste stimuli to both sides of the tongue in three different groups of subjects. SUBJECTS AND METHODS: Thirty healthy normal-weight volunteers, 19 healthy overweight subjects, and 22 obese subjects were enrolled. For each subject, the lateralization Oldfield score, body weight, height, and blood pressure were determined. The taste test is based on filter paper strips soaked with 4 taste stimuli presented at different concentrations to evoke 4 basic taste qualities (salty, sour, sweet, and bitter); pure rapeseed oil and water were also administered to evoke fat and neutral taste qualities. The stimuli were applied to each side of the protruded tongue. Subjects were asked to identify the taste from a list of eight descriptions according to a multiple choice paradigm. RESULTS: The results showed a general lowering of taste sensitivity with the increase of BMI, except for the taste of fat with rapeseed oil as the stimulus. Other variables affecting taste sensitivity are age (negative association), gender (women generally show higher sensitivity), and taste stimuli concentration (positive association). CONCLUSIONS: Our findings could provide important insights into how new therapies could be designed for weight loss and long-term weight maintenance and how diets could be planned combining the correct caloric and nutritional supply with individual taste preferences.
